Croydon Veterinary Clinic Originally the clinic was opened in the 1960’s by Dr Malcolm Fitzpatrick , who was later joined by Dr John Cooper in the 1970’s. Dr Ursula Retchford began working for Dr Cooper in 1998, and upon his retirement, took over the practice in 2005. Dr Matthew Retchford joined the practice in 2006. Over that time the premises have been extended and new technology such as ultrasound, endoscopy and direct digital radiography have been incorporated into the services available.
